We Mine The Night
We Mine The Night is a breathtaking journey across time and space that chronicles three of humanity’s final moments—and the vast, unknowable future that follows.
As Earth breathes its last, six-year-old Azianna clutches her mother’s hand, watching the planet shrink behind the last ship to soar beyond the sky. Ahead lies uncertainty, a new world filled with unknown adventures, and the chance for humanity to survive.
Eons later, in a dark cathedral, Selene kneels in reverence to the Long Night. The eternal darkness welcomes all humanity. On a Dyson sphere enveloped in night, memories of starlight are fading, but she learns the light of the stars will always be a part of them in some way.
Aboard the worldship Chandra, Captain Etu charts a course through a universe that no longer remembers its beginning. The celebration of Half-Day marks a milestone in the endless journey and reminds Etu and his people that even in endless night, humanity’s fire still burns.
A tale of resilience and transformation, We Mine The Night dares to ask: when the stars are gone, what will we become?
